Your Essential Guide to Buying RV Backup Cameras Wireless
Driving a big RV can be tough. Backing up? Even tougher! A wireless backup camera makes life much easier and safer. This guide helps you pick the best one for your adventures.
Key Features to Look For
When shopping, check these important parts first. They decide how well your camera works.
1. Video Quality and Night Vision
- Resolution: Look for at least 720p (HD). Higher numbers mean clearer pictures. Clear pictures help you see small details when backing up.
- Night Vision: Good cameras use infrared (IR) LEDs. These let you see clearly even when it is totally dark outside. This is super important for safety at campgrounds after sunset.
2. Wireless Range and Signal Stability
- Range: Your RV is long. You need a camera system that sends a strong signal from the back to the front screen. Check the advertised range.
- Interference: Cheap systems often lose the signal when passing under power lines or near other electronics. Look for systems that use strong, stable digital signals, not old analog ones.
3. Screen Size and Mounting
- Monitor Size: A bigger screen (like 5 inches or more) is easier to see quickly. Make sure the screen fits nicely on your dashboard without blocking your view.
- Mounting Options: Can the camera mount easily on your RV bumper or ladder? Does the monitor suction cup or screw securely?
Important Materials and Durability
RVs go everywhere. Your camera needs to handle sun, rain, and bumps. The materials matter a lot.
Camera Housing
- Waterproofing Rating: Look for an IP67 or IP68 rating. This means the camera is protected against heavy rain and dust. You do not want water getting inside the camera.
- Lens Material: Glass lenses last longer and stay clearer than plastic lenses. Plastic scratches easily from road dirt.
Wiring and Connections (Even Wireless Needs Some Wires!)
While the signal is wireless, the camera needs power. Ensure the power cables are thick and well-sealed where they connect to your RV’s lights or power source. Good insulation stops corrosion.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
Some features make a system great; others make it frustrating.
Quality Boosters:
- Adjustable Guidelines: These colored lines overlay the video, helping you judge distance when reversing. Adjustable lines let you set them perfectly for your RV’s size.
- Wide Viewing Angle: A 120-degree to 170-degree angle lets you see more of the sides, reducing blind spots.
- Low Latency: This means the image appears on the screen right away. High latency (delay) makes backing up dangerous.
Quality Reducers:
- Proprietary Charging: If the system uses a weird, non-standard charger, you might lose power on a long trip and not find a replacement easily.
- Poor Heat Resistance: If you park in the hot desert sun, cheap cameras can overheat and shut down.
User Experience and Use Cases
Think about how you actually use your RV. A good camera adapts to your driving style.
Ease of Installation
Wireless systems are easier to install than wired ones because you skip running long cables through walls. However, you still need to connect the camera to power (often to the taillights) and the monitor to the dashboard power. Simple, plug-and-play connectors improve the experience greatly.
Use Cases
- Hitching Trailers: If you often tow a small trailer behind your RV, a good camera helps you line up the hitch perfectly without needing a spotter every time.
- Tight Campgrounds: When backing into a small campsite spot surrounded by trees or other RVs, the camera gives you the confidence to maneuver slowly and safely.
- Blind Spot Check: The camera helps you see things low to the ground, like curbs, small rocks, or children playing near the rear bumper—things your mirrors miss completely.
10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About RV Backup Cameras Wireless
Q: How do wireless RV cameras get power?
A: Most cameras connect to your RV’s existing taillights or reverse lights. When you put the RV in reverse, the camera turns on automatically. Others use a dedicated power cable plugged into a 12V outlet.
Q: Will the wireless signal work through my metal RV walls?
A: Modern digital systems usually handle metal well, but very large, thick metal walls can weaken the signal. Look for systems specifically advertised for long-haul trucks or large RVs to ensure the signal stays strong.
Q: Do I need a separate monitor, or can it connect to my phone?
A: Most dedicated RV systems come with their own monitor. Some newer, simpler systems let you view the feed on a smartphone app, but dedicated monitors usually have less lag (delay).
Q: How hard is it to install a wireless camera system myself?
A: Installation is much easier than wired systems. You mainly need to drill a small hole for the power wire and mount the camera and monitor. If you are comfortable handling basic tools, you can usually install it in a few hours.
Q: What happens if the wireless signal drops while I am backing up?
A: If the signal drops, the screen usually goes black or shows a “No Signal” message. This is why choosing a system with excellent range and stability is crucial. Never rely solely on the camera; always check your mirrors too!
Q: Can I leave the camera on all the time to monitor traffic behind me?
A: Yes, many systems allow continuous viewing, acting like a digital rearview mirror. However, you must check your local laws, as continuous use while driving might be regulated.
Q: Are these cameras weatherproof enough for all seasons?
A: A good quality camera rated IP67 or IP69K is designed to handle heavy rain, snow, and high-pressure washing. Always check the specific IP rating provided by the manufacturer.
Q: What is the difference between analog and digital wireless cameras?
A: Analog signals are older, cheaper, and easily interrupted by interference. Digital signals are clearer, more secure, and offer better range, making them the better choice for large RVs.
Q: If I buy a system with two cameras, how do I switch between them?
A: Most dual-camera systems let you switch views using a button on the monitor. Some advanced systems automatically switch to the side camera when you signal a turn.
Q: Does the camera automatically turn on when I put the RV in reverse?
A: Yes, if you wire the camera correctly to your reverse lights, it powers on automatically when you shift into reverse. This is the best setup for safety and convenience.
